Link with hpc even if GhcWithInterpreter is not set
authorIan Lynagh <igloo@earth.li>
Thu, 26 Jul 2007 16:42:01 +0000 (16:42 +0000)
committerIan Lynagh <igloo@earth.li>
Thu, 26 Jul 2007 16:42:01 +0000 (16:42 +0000)
compiler/Makefile

index 0b84536..252da0d 100644 (file)
@@ -410,11 +410,16 @@ endif
 # enabled when we are bootstrapping with the same version of GHC, and
 # the interpreter is supported on this platform.
 
+ifeq "$(bootstrapped)" "YES"
+SRC_HC_OPTS += -package hpc
+PKG_DEPENDS += hpc
+endif
+
 ifeq "$(GhcWithInterpreter) $(bootstrapped)" "YES YES"
 
 # Yes, include the interepreter, readline, and Template Haskell extensions
-SRC_HC_OPTS += -DGHCI -package template-haskell -package hpc
-PKG_DEPENDS += template-haskell hpc
+SRC_HC_OPTS += -DGHCI -package template-haskell
+PKG_DEPENDS += template-haskell
 
 # Should GHCI be building info tables in the TABLES_NEXT_TO_CODE style
 # or not?